Liverpool are reportedly set to join the race for Leeds United's Kalvin Phillips, who is a target for a number of Premier League clubs.

Liverpool are reportedly set to join the race to sign England international Kalvin Phillips.

Despite struggling with injuries, Phillips still managed to appear in 23 games for Leeds United in the 2021-22 season, with his performances catching the eye of a number of Premier League clubs.

A recent report indicated that Chelsea had shown an interest in the midfielder, alongside the likes of Manchester City and Manchester United who have also been linked with the 26-year-old.

However, according to The Mirror, Liverpool are also set to rival their fellow Premier League clubs for the Englishman's signature.

The report indicates that the Reds are expected to miss out on their primary target Aurelien Tchouameni, which has forced Liverpool into looking at alternatives.

A potential deal for Phillips is likely to cost in the region of £60m, and Jurgen Klopp's side know they face heavy competition for the Leeds academy product.

Phillips has scored 14 goals across 234 for appearances for the Yorkshire club.
